Common English name: Lesser Bicoloured Roundleaf Bat Barcode Index Number: BOLD : ACE 5015 (2 DNA barcodes from Peninsular Malaysia ) and BOLD : ACE 6229 (11 DNA barcodes from Peninsular Malaysia ). The two BINs showed less than 2% of divergence in COI mtDNA ( Fig 4 ). Also see records of H . bicolor sensu lato above. Roosting colonies of H . atrox vary from a few to hundreds of individuals [ 17 ]. The species has a wide range of habitat: limestone caves, hill and lowland primary forests, secondary forests, and even highly disturbed areas including plantations and human residences [ 11 , 14 , 23 , 17 ]. Individuals have been reported roosting with other Hipposideros species [ 17 ].
